利用历史文献重建 10 至 13 世纪中国东部地区的耕地覆盖变化。

Reconstruction of the cropland cover changes in eastern China between the 10 century and 13 century using historical documents.

Abstract

To evaluate and improve datasets of anthropogenic land cover change used in local and global climate models, great efforts were made to reconstruct historical land use, including the LandCover 6k project which dedicated to reconstructing human land use over the past 10,000 years. In this study, we utilized historical records, including taxed-cropland and cropland measurement areas, and data on the number of households in eastern China between the 10 century and 13 century in concert with coefficient calibration, model allocation, and per capita cropland estimation to reconstruct areas of provincial cropland for 22 provinces over five time periods. Our reconstructions indicate that total cropland areas of eastern China for AD 1000, 1066, 1078, 1162, and 1215 are 34.74 × 10 ha, 49.42 × 10 ha, 51.62 × 10 ha, 35.21 × 10 ha, and 51.21 × 10 ha, respectively. And the cropland area fluctuated because of dynasty shift and went through three phases. Cropland expansion and contraction mainly occurred in the middle and lower reaches of the Yangtze and Yellow Rivers as well as the Huaihe River Basin, while in some regions far away from battlefields, including northeastern and southern China, cropland area expanded continuously throughout the study period.

摘要

为了评估和改进用于地方和全球气候模型的人为土地覆盖变化数据集,人们做出了巨大努力来重建历史土地利用情况,包括致力于重建过去 10000 年人类土地利用情况的 LandCover 6k 项目。在这项研究中,我们利用了历史记录,包括纳税耕地和耕地测量区,以及 10 世纪至 13 世纪中国东部的家庭户数数据,同时进行系数校准、模型分配和人均耕地估计,以重建中国东部 22 个省份五个时期的省级耕地面积。我们的重建结果表明,公元 1000 年、1066 年、1078 年、1162 年和 1215 年中国东部的耕地总面积分别为 34.74×10^4 公顷、49.42×10^4 公顷、51.62×10^4 公顷、35.21×10^4 公顷和 51.21×10^4 公顷。由于朝代更迭,耕地面积出现波动,并经历了三个阶段。耕地的扩张和收缩主要发生在长江、黄河中下游和淮河流域,而在远离战场的一些地区,包括中国东北和南方,耕地面积在整个研究期间持续扩张。
